>> Is anyone else having problems clicking buttons on HUDs when running the
>> latest release SVN? The coordinates seem to be getting scaled wrong when
>> clicking them, so HUDs at my bottom left work fine, while ones further
>> towards the top or right I have to click to the right of or above them to
>> make them work, which obviously isn't possible when they're at the edge.
>>
>> I suspect this may be to do with the new touch position detection stuff
>> that's just gone in? Though this is just with my ordinary existing HUDs.
